The Insane Amount Of Booze Consumed In Texas
A recent study into the drinking habits of Texans produced some pretty insane numbers when it comes to how much we drink. The study, by MyBioSource, examined our drinking habits during the winter months.

What they found is that Texans, over the winter, put away 761,689,602 alcoholic drinks. That is an insane number of drinks.
Considering that alcohol isn't that difficult to find, you can get it delivered to your house, and that insane number of drinks starts to make more sense. Texas has a massive population, and a lot of us like to have a drink once in a while.
Why Do People From Texas Drink So Much
The reasons why we drank so much may not be what you might expect. I originally thought it would be stress. You had the election, costs were going up, and when some people get stressed, they drink.
That was only part of the story. The study broke down the reasons why we drink, and the number one reason was socializing. Half of the people surveyed said that was the top reason.

It makes sense considering the winter holidays are all about getting together with loved ones. Plus, we all like to toast the new year when it finally rolls around.
The most popular drink was wine, which isn't surprising considering Texas has over 400 wineries. Beer was a close second. Vodka and Whiskey tied for third.
